


3-Card Combination
Transformation Through Burdens and New Beginnings
This reading highlights a profound transition where the end of a cycle meets the weight of responsibilities, yet promises new opportunities for growth. The combination of these cards emphasizes the importance of letting go of what no longer serves you while being open to learning and new paths.
Death
Upright: endings, change, transformation, transition
Reversed: resistance to change, inability to move on
Ten of Wands
Upright: burden, extra responsibility, hard work, completion
Reversed: inability to delegate, carrying too much, burnout
Page of Pentacles
Upright: ambition, desire, diligence, new beginnings
Reversed: lack of progress, procrastination, learn from failure
All Upright
When all three cards are upright, they indicate a powerful transformation ahead. The Death card signifies the end of an old chapter, allowing you to release burdens symbolized by the Ten of Wands. This release paves the way for the Page of Pentacles, representing the beginnings of new ventures and opportunities for growth and learning.
Death Reversed
With the Death card reversed, there may be resistance to change, leading to stagnation or clinging to past situations. This can intensify the weight of the Ten of Wands, where responsibilities feel inescapable. It’s essential to recognize what needs to be released to avoid feeling overwhelmed.
Ten of Wands Reversed
The reversed Ten of Wands suggests a need to reassess your burdens and possibly delegate responsibilities. This card indicates that you may be holding onto too much, which hinders your progress. Letting go of unnecessary obligations can help create space for new opportunities.
Page of Pentacles Reversed
The Page of Pentacles reversed may indicate missed opportunities or a lack of focus on personal growth and practical matters. You might be feeling uninspired or unsure about pursuing new ideas. It’s a prompt to reconnect with your ambitions and explore your potential more actively.
All Reversed
When all three cards are reversed, the energy is stagnant, filled with resistance to change, overwhelming burdens, and missed opportunities. This combination suggests a need for deep reflection on what is holding you back. It's crucial to confront these issues to initiate the necessary transformation.
Love & Relationships
In love and relationships, this combination can signify difficulties in moving past old wounds or patterns. If you're feeling overwhelmed by the demands of a relationship, it may be time to address these burdens together or reassess what you truly want. Open communication is essential to facilitate healing and growth.
Career & Finances
In your career, this reading suggests that you may be feeling stuck or burdened by responsibilities that impede your professional growth. The reversed Page of Pentacles hints at missed opportunities for advancement or learning. Consider seeking support and re-evaluating your current path to open new doors.
Advice
Your path forward involves embracing change and letting go of what no longer serves you. Take time to identify and release the burdens that are weighing you down. Focus on small, achievable goals that will reignite your passion and enthusiasm for new beginnings.
